Greek island of Lesbos fights for its name
-- 05/05/2008

Question 1 of 5

Q: Some inhabitants of the Greek island of Lesbos have filed a lawsuit to stop the use of the word 'lesbian' in the name of a local gay rights organization. The group says that if their suit is successful, they will attempt to raise their challenge to an international level to reclaim the designation as the way the islanders refer to themselves.
